The Power of Choice: How it Can Decrease Stress in Dogs
With Irith Bloom and Kristina Spaulding

Join Dr. Kristina Spaulding and Irith Bloom for two days of in-person interactive learning with working spots for 12 dogs. Kristina and Irith will present on the power of giving dogs choices and explain how increasing choice can decrease dogs’ stress and modify their behavior in a positive way.
This workshop will give pet parents tools for making their own dog’s life happier, as well as help pet professionals hone their assessment and training/behavior plan development skills so they can work more successfully with dogs who are stressed out and have behavior issues.
The workshop is open to everyone interested in decreasing stress and improving behavior, from pet parents to trainers, behavior consultants, veterinarians and shelter staff.
